The three two barrel carb option was the M code 390 with higher compression and higher flow heads. I figured it was a 406 but those were for the bigger cars. I like the FE series engines 352- 428 big blocks with the factory horse power options.

Most of their kits are decades old. Technically they don’t even really exist as a company anymore. Round 2 just basically bought up all the names of the old model companies and rereleases all their old kits periodically.

The Tire Packing is Due to the new Pad printed Whitewall areas. This stuff can scuff up if they're packaged loosely like just 4 tire in plastic bags. So isolated by this bag tight method keeps them perfect on Whitewalls & this tyoe package is new due to Round 2 in the new "Retro Deluxes" format enhanced Tires n parts like. Red/Blue/ Gray tint Glass options and parts retuned to kits missing for 15-20 years Sometimes. It makes these Deluxe kits sometimes a Bargain over same kit but earlier issue @ 50% of price off ebay.
